I am ok with the interior, but the thing that bothers me a bit is that the place where it meets the rim of 41896 is one ldu too large, and the lip of tire is slightly offset (one ldu too I think) in 41896 groove.
Look at it with an opaque 41896 and a trans tire. Now if you decide it's OK I'll follow you, it's impossible to tell with in black color!!!
To avoid these problems, I build the tire section that meets the wheel from the wheel itself, stripping it down to its rim and add a few invertnext...
